Plot Summary
The film tells the story of Hasan, a humble baker who dreams of winning the heart of a beautiful woman. His simple life takes a turn when he gets involved in a series of comical misunderstandings and challenges. Hasan must navigate through various situations, relying on his wit and determination to overcome obstacles and prove his worth.
